What Are Dosing Pumps?
Dosing pumps are precision instruments designed to infuse small but accurate amounts of a liquid into a particular system or mix. From chemical treatment in water purification plants to pharmaceutical manufacturing, dosing pumps play a vital role in a wide array of industries. These pumps help in maintaining exact chemical concentrations, thereby enhancing operational efficiency and productivity. Their ability to dispense exact volumes makes them indispensable where precision is paramount.
How Do Dosing Pumps Work?
The operation of dosing pumps revolves around a simple yet effective method of capturing and releasing fluids. Most dosing pumps operate through a cyclic sequence known as the suction stroke and discharge stroke. Essentially, the pump draws the liquid into the chamber and then expels it with precision. Flow rate and capacity can be easily controlled, making dosing pumps extremely versatile. Types of Dosing Pumps
There are various types of dosing pumps, each suited for different kinds of applications. The most common types include diaphragm pumps, peristaltic pumps, and piston pumps. Each type has its own unique operational method as well as specific applications. Diaphragm pumps, for example, are known for high precision and chemical resistance, while peristaltic pumps are often used for materials that are viscous or abrasive. Industries Utilizing Dosing Pumps
Dosing pumps are an integral part of numerous industries such as food processing, water treatment, pharmaceuticals, and more. In food processing, they are used to add exact ingredients to mixtures. In water treatment, dosing pumps help administer chemicals needed to purify water. This makes them essential tools for maintaining both industrial efficiencies and safety standards. Maintaining Dosing Pumps
Maintenance is key to ensuring the optimal functioning of dosing pumps. Regular checks can help identify wear and tear, thus preventing downtimes. Keeping parts clean, checking for leaks, and making sure the calibration is correct are basic but essential steps.
